[(1S,8R)-2,3,5,6,7,8-hexahydro-1H-pyrrolizin-1-yl]methyl 3,5-bis(3-methylbut-2-enyl)-4-[(2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xybenzoate

Also Known As: Auriculine, J2.772.237G, [(1S,8R)-2,3,5,6,7,8-hexahydro-1H-pyrrolizin-1-yl]methyl 3,5-bis(3-methylbut-2-enyl)-4-[(2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xybenzoate, ((1S,7AR)-hexahydro-1H-pyrrolizin-1-yl)methyl 3,5-bis(3-methylbut-2-en-1-yl)-4-(((2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)tetrahydro-2H-pyran-2-yl)oxy)benzoate, ((1S,7aR)-Hexahydro-1H-pyrrolizin-1-yl)methyl 4-(beta-D-glucopyranosyloxy)-3,5-bis(3-methyl-2-buten-1-yl)benzoate

CAS: 22595-00-2
Molecular Formula C31H45NO8
Molecular Weight 559.31 g/mol
LogP 4.4
Topological Polar Surface Area 129.0 Ų
Hydrogen Bond Donors 4
Hydrogen Bond Acceptors 9
Rotatable Bonds 11
Exact Mass 559.3145
Heavy Atoms 40
Complexity 870.0

Chemical Identifiers

CAS Number 22595-00-2
SMILES CC(=CCC1=CC(=CC(=C1O[C@H]2[C@@H]([C@H]([C@@H]([C@H](O2)CO)O)O)O)CC=C(C)C)C(=O)OC[C@H]3CCN4[C@@H]3CCC4)C
InChIKey FQXZITIIHQHGBC-KRYJLITLSA-N

Property Insights of Auriculine

The XLogP value of 4.4 indicates that Auriculine is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 129.0 Ų falls within the moderate polarity range, balancing permeability and solubility for Auriculine. Following Lipinski's Rule of Five, Auriculine has 4 hydrogen bond donor(s) and 9 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
